Who was the incumbent that Schmitt defeated in the 1976 Senate race?

  • Robert Byrd

  • Edward Kennedy

  • Joseph Montoya

  • None of the above

Answer

Joseph Montoya was the incumbent that Schmitt defeated in the 1976 Senate race. Montoya had been in office since 1957, and was considered a powerful and popular figure in New Mexico politics. However, Schmitt was able to capitalize on Montoya's declining popularity and win the election by a narrow margin.
